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Stellt spezielle Formatierungen dar, die bestimmten Bereichen einer Tabelle zugewiesen sind, wenn die ausgewählte Tabelle mit einer angegebenen Tabellenformatvorlage formatiert ist.
Hinweise
Verwenden Sie die Condition-Methode des TableStyle-Objekts , um ein ConditionalStyle-Objekt zurückzugeben. Die Schattierungseigenschaft kann verwendet werden, um Schattierung auf bestimmte Bereiche einer Tabelle anzuwenden. In diesem Beispiel wird die erste Tabelle im aktiven Dokument ausgewählt und eine Schattierung auf alternative Zeilen und Spalten angewendet. In diesem Beispiel wird davon ausgegangen, dass im aktiven Dokument eine Tabelle vorhanden ist und dass es mit dem Tabellenrasterformat formatiert ist.
Sub ApplyConditionalStyle()
With ActiveDocument
.Tables(1).Select
With .Styles("Table Grid").Table
.Condition(wdOddColumnBanding).Shading _
.BackgroundPatternColor = wdColorGray10
.Condition(wdOddRowBanding).Shading _
.BackgroundPatternColor = wdColorGray10
End With
End With
End Sub
Verwenden Sie die Borders-Eigenschaft , um Rahmen auf bestimmte Bereiche einer Tabelle anzuwenden. In diesem Beispiel wird die erste Tabelle im aktiven Dokument ausgewählt und Rahmen auf die erste und letzte Zeile und erste Spalte angewendet. In diesem Beispiel wird davon ausgegangen, dass im aktiven Dokument eine Tabelle vorhanden ist und dass es mit dem Tabellenrasterformat formatiert ist.
Sub ApplyTableBorders()
With ActiveDocument
.Tables(1).Select
With .Styles("Table Grid").Table
.Condition(wdFirstRow).Borders(wdBorderBottom) _
.LineStyle = wdLineStyleDouble
.Condition(wdFirstColumn).Borders(wdBorderRight) _
.LineStyle = wdLineStyleDouble
.Condition(wdLastRow).Borders(wdBorderTop) _
.LineStyle = wdLineStyleDouble
End With
End With
End Sub
Siehe auch
Referenz zum Word-Objektmodell
Support und Feedback
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.